Akali Dal sets up panel for Delhi polls seat-sharing
Chandigarh
06-January-2020
Shiromani Akali Dal (SAD) President Sukhbir Singh Badal on Monday formed a three-member committee to hold talks with the BJP for seat-sharing and campaign coordination in the February 8 Delhi Assembly elections.
The members of the committee are MPs Balwinder Singh Bhundur, Prem Singh Chandumajra and Naresh Gujral.
In a statement here, Sukhbir Badal said the committee would hold discussions with the Delhi BJP unit as well as its central leadership as per need to ensure smooth coordination between the alliance partners for the Delhi elections.
In the current assembly, the SAD has lone legislator Manjinder Singh Sirsa, elected in a bypoll.IANS
